XSEED launches XSEED MAX at “School of Tomorrow” conference – Mint Reports

XSEED, a global learning company, on Saturday launched an education technology solution called XSEED MAX that blends hands-on and digital learning in classrooms and allows parents to track each child’s results. The Singapore-based firm aims to expand its presence to 10,000 schools in India by 2020 from roughly 3,000 currently, its founder said.
The new edu-tech solution launched at XSEED’s ninth School of Tomorrow conference involves schools that follow the firm’s curriculum conducting a weekly digital learning class in mathematics and science based on its teaching methods for grades 1-8. At these weekly classes, children focus on 25 critical concepts in both subjects, one concept at a time.
